Description of the Position:

Responsible for providing direction to Forklift Operators, training, assigning work, and resolving

problems within area of responsibility. Operates gasoline-, liquefied gas-, or electric-powered

industrial equipment equipped with lifting devices, such as sit-down, stand-up, clamp or other

elevating equipment to push, pull, lift, stack, tier, or move products, equipment, or materials

from rail cars in distribution center or storage yard.

  • Supports and trains newly hired forklift operators within their area of responsibility.
  • Assists supervisors and management of the facility in planning, assigning, and directing work
  • Load, unload, move, stock, and stage products and materials using powered industrial

equipment. Maintain equipment and materials in a neat, clean and orderly fashion. On a

daily basis, inspect assigned equipment. Operate all equipment in a safe and efficient

manner following prescribed work methods and OSHA standards.

  • Unload inbound shipments safely and move product to storage locations. Efficiently stack

and store product in the appropriate areas.

  • Pull and prepare products for shipment, ensuring the exact number and types of products

are loaded and shipped.

  • Efficiently move product from staging and/or storage areas into rail cars, trailers, or

containers.

  • Ensure inbound and outbound shipments are accurate and free of damage. Report quality

variances.

  • Inventories materials on work floor and supply workers with materials as needed.
  • Follow customer requirements and/or other instructions to ensure accuracy: load count,

stability of product, and that all products are loaded and unloaded safely.

  • Coordinate as necessary with all other departments/functions, especially Customer Service,

Transportation and Maintenance.

  • Perform good housekeeping practices, clean as you go process.
  • Conduct operations and equipment in a manner that promotes safety and report unsafe

conditions that can't be self-corrected to the leadership team.

  • Follow corporate and site-specific Good Manufacturing Practices and report noncompliance

when observed.

  • Observe all company safety rules and assist in enforcement as appropriate.
